Vertical lines do not qualify as functions because they fail the vertical line test. A function must map each input (x-coordinate) to exactly one output (y-coordinate), but vertical lines assign multiple outputs to a single input.

For instance, if the line passes through the point (4, 7), the equation is simply x = 4. This equation applies to all points where the x-coordinate equals 4, regardless of the y-coordinate.

The slope is undefined because the run (horizontal change) is 0, making the slope calculation invalid.
